FUEGO TO MEET CHIVAS USA IN RUBBER MATCH MLS team returns to Fresno following November loss Fresno, Calif. – The Fresno Fuego announced today that the team will take on Chivas USA from Major League Soccer in an exhibition match on Sunday, March 16 at Chukchansi Park at 4:00 p.m. This will be the third meeting between the two clubs in the last year. Chivas won the first match, 5-0 last March, and the Fuego shocked the MLS squad 3-1 in their last match-up in November. Chivas USA will bring its entire squad to Fresno for this game, as a tune-up for the MLS season which begins on March 30. There will be two preliminary games played prior to the Fuego/Chivas USA match-up. The California Odyssey 91 Boys will take on the Colorado Rush 91 Boys at 10:30 a.m., and the California Odyssey 89 Boys match up against the Colorado Rush 89 Boys at 12:30 p.m. Both of the preliminary matches are league games for the U.S. Soccer Academy, a grouping of which only 64 teams across the country are part of. The league is in its first season, and features the elite players of youth soccer in the United States. Tickets for the game will go on sale at the Chukchansi Park Box Office on Tuesday, March 4. The cost of tickets bought prior to the day of the game is $15. Tickets will be available on the day of the game for $20. Kids’ tickets (10 and younger) are free. The Fuego open the 2008 season on Saturday, April 26, when they host the San Francisco Seals at 7:00 p.m. at Chukchansi Park. The Fresno Fuego captured the 2007 PDL Western Conference Championship, and advanced to the National Semifinals. For more information on the Fuego, call (559) 320-4487. |
